How it feels
A tense, atmospheric puzzle-platformer where a boy and his silent companion creep through a dark, decaying city, solving environmental puzzles and evading grotesque horrors together.

What players say
Players praise the tense atmosphere and unsettling enemy designs, especially the Teacher. The story is told without dialogue, and the ending is a frequent topic. Some note the partner AI is helpful, while a few mention minor technical issues or clunky movement.
